https://bayt.page.link/rJEiN5bqVkxotczJ6
Create a job alert for similar positions

Job Description

Imagine being a part of an agile team where your ideas have the potential to reach millions. Picture working on impactful consumer-facing products, where every single team member is a critical voice in the decision-making process. Envision being able to leverage the resources of a Fortune-500 company within the atmosphere of a start-up. Welcome to Amazon Music, where ideas are born and come to life as Amazon Music Unlimited, Prime Music, and so much more.
Key job responsibilities
We are looking for a passionate, hard-working, and talented senior-level full-stack software engineer with a track record of successfully delivering new features and products, solving hard problems, and learning new technologies quickly. Your job will be to work with a team of engineers across iOS, Android, Web visual client platforms and product managers to solve new problems in new ways. The problem space expects leveraging new technologies to innovate and simplify the client architectures, driving cloud based solutions and building REST/GraphQL-based micro services. You’ll also be coaching other engineers, developing engineering and operational processes, and encouraging excellence within the team.
Responsibilities:
- Lead definition, architecture, and design of software components, solution designs, tools, and tests
- Mentor and coach other engineers on the team, encouraging engineering excellence
- Will help to define and push for the best possible end-user experience
- Contribute to team discussions around solution and component design as well as process improvement
- Design, develop, and maintain high-quality, high-performance, maintainable code
- Work in an Agile/Scrum environment, participating in prioritization, estimation, and sprint planning
- 5+ years of non-internship professional software development experience
- 5+ years of programming with at least one software programming language experience
- 5+ years of leading design or architecture (design patterns, reliability and scaling) of new and existing systems experience
- Experience as a mentor, tech lead or leading an engineering team
- 5+ years of full software development life cycle, including coding standards, code reviews, source control management, build processes, testing, and operations experience
- Bachelor's degree in computer science or equivalent
Our inclusive culture empowers Amazonians to deliver the best results for our customers. If you have a disability and need a workplace accommodation or adjustment during the application and hiring process, including support for the interview or onboarding process, please visit https://amazon.jobs/content/en/how-we-hire/accommodations for more information. If the country/region you’re applying in isn’t listed, please contact your Recruiting Partner.



You have reached your limit of 15 Job Alerts. To create a new Job Alert, delete one of your existing Job Alerts first.
Similar jobs alert created successfully. You can manage alerts in settings.
Similar jobs alert disabled successfully. You can manage alerts in settings.